Segment 2: Why Businesses are Turning to Fractional CFOs

So, why are more businesses choosing to hire fractional CFOs? There are several key reasons driving this trend.

1. Cost-Effective Expertise:
Hiring a full-time CFO can be a significant financial burden, especially for startups and small businesses. A fractional CFO allows companies to tap into the expertise of a seasoned financial leader at a fraction of the cost. This means businesses can allocate resources more efficiently, investing in growth while still benefiting from expert financial guidance.

2. Flexibility and Scalability:
Business needs can change quickly, especially in today’s fast-paced environment. A fractional CFO offers the flexibility to scale their involvement up or down based on the company’s current needs. Whether you’re preparing for a funding round, navigating a cash flow challenge, or planning an expansion, a fractional CFO can provide the right level of support at the right time.

Segment 3: The Role and Responsibilities of a Fractional CFO

Now that we’ve covered why businesses are turning to fractional CFOs, let’s dive deeper into what a fractional CFO actually does. Their role can be quite broad, depending on the company’s needs, but here are some of the key responsibilities they typically take on:

1. Financial Strategy and Planning:
One of the primary roles of a fractional CFO is to develop and implement financial strategies that align with the company’s overall goals. This might involve creating financial forecasts, budgeting, and setting financial targets that support business growth.

2. Cash Flow Management:
Effective cash flow management is crucial for any business, particularly for startups and growing companies. A fractional CFO helps ensure that cash flow is optimized, identifying potential issues before they become critical and advising on how to maintain liquidity.

3. Fundraising and Investor Relations:
For startups and growth-stage companies, securing funding is often a top priority. Fractional CFOs bring expertise in fundraising, helping to prepare financials for investors, develop pitch materials, and negotiate with potential investors.
